Oloroso is a variety of sherry produced by oxidative aging. It is normally darker than amontillado and
has a higher glycerine content, wich makes it smoother and less dry.Unlike the fino and amontillado
sherries, in oloroso sherries the flor yeasts suppressed by fortification at an earlier stage.
This causes the finished wine to lack the fresh yeasty taste of the fino sherries.
Without the layer of flor, the sherry is exposed to air through the slightly porous walls of the American or Canadian oak casks,
and undergoes oxidative aging. As the wine ages, it becomes darker and stronger and is often left for many decades.
